featherback

American  
[feth-er-bak] / ˈfɛð ərˌbæk /

noun

  1. any freshwater fish of the family Notopteridae, of Asia and western Africa, having a small, feathery dorsal fin and a very long anal fin extending from close behind the head to the tip of the tail.


Etymology

Origin of featherback

feather + back 1
